Subject: [PATCH] Documentation: x86: fix boot.rst warning and format
Date: Sun, 8 Dec 2019 20:25:10 -0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<c6fbf592-0aca-69d9-e903-e869221a041a@infradead.org> (raw)
From: Randy Dunlap <rdunlap@infradead.org>
Fix a Sphinx documentation format warning by breaking a long line
into 2 lines.
Also drop the ':' usage after the Protocol version numbers since
other Protocol versions don't use colons.
Documentation/x86/boot.rst:72: WARNING: Malformed table.
Text in column margin in table line 57.
Fixes: 2c33c27fd603 ("x86/boot: Introduce kernel_info")
Fixes: 00cd1c154d56 ("x86/boot: Introduce kernel_info.setup_type_max")
